Sulfur is a critical mineral for human health, but the term 'sulfide' can be misleading. In nutrition, we typically discuss sulfur-containing compounds, not pure sulfides. These compounds include sulfur-containing amino acids (like methionine and cysteine), beneficial organosulfur compounds, and preservatives known as sulfites. In the gut, certain bacteria called sulfate-reducing bacteria (SRB) convert these compounds into hydrogen sulfide, which is a key sulfide produced in the body. A balanced intake of sulfur-rich foods is vital for supporting bodily functions, but high amounts may affect those with specific sensitivities or inflammatory bowel conditions.

Key Food Categories High in Sulfides (Sulfur)

Many foods are naturally rich in sulfur, contributing to our overall intake. These foods are generally healthy, though their impact can vary between individuals.

Allium Vegetables

Allium vegetables, renowned for their distinct flavors and pungent aromas, are packed with organosulfur compounds. Crushing or chopping these vegetables activates enzymes that convert odorless precursors into volatile compounds, including beneficial sulfides like diallyl sulfide.

  • Garlic: Known for its potent allicin content, activated upon crushing. Research highlights garlic's antioxidant and anti-inflammatory properties, often linked to its sulfur compounds.
  • Onions: Contain a variety of sulfides and are also a rich source of flavonoids like quercetin.
  • Leeks and Shallots: Provide similar organosulfur compounds, offering milder flavors than garlic and onions.

Cruciferous Vegetables

This vegetable family contains glucosinolates, which are converted into active sulfur compounds like sulforaphane when chewed or chopped. These compounds are linked to anti-cancer and antioxidant effects.

  • Broccoli, Cauliflower, and Cabbage: Primary examples of cruciferous vegetables with high sulfur content.
  • Brussels Sprouts and Kale: Other key members of this group contributing to dietary sulfur.

Protein-Rich Animal Foods

Animal proteins are significant sources of sulfur-containing amino acids, especially methionine and cysteine, which are essential for protein synthesis and metabolism.

  • Meat and Poultry: Beef, chicken, and organ meats like liver are particularly high in these sulfur amino acids.
  • Seafood: Many types of fish and shellfish, such as shrimp, scallops, and crab, are also high in sulfur.
  • Eggs: A major dietary source of sulfur, primarily from the amino acid methionine. The distinctive 'rotten egg' smell associated with overcooked eggs is due to the release of hydrogen sulfide gas.

Dairy Products

Dairy, especially aged cheeses, contains sulfur compounds that contribute to its flavor profile. The fermentation process can increase the concentration of these compounds.

  • Milk and Cheeses: Whole eggs, cow's milk, cheddar, and parmesan cheese are noted for their sulfur content.

Legumes, Nuts, and Seeds

For plant-based diets, these foods are an important source of sulfur.

  • Soybeans, Black Beans, and Kidney Beans: Legumes that contain high levels of sulfur.
  • Almonds, Brazil Nuts, and Sesame Seeds: Nuts and seeds rich in sulfur.

Dried Fruits and Sulfite Preservatives

Sulfites, a sulfur-based food preservative, are commonly added to many packaged and processed foods to extend their shelf life and prevent browning.

  • Dried Fruits: Dried apricots, raisins, and figs are often treated with sulfites.
  • Fermented Beverages: Wine, beer, and cider contain naturally occurring or added sulfites.

The Role of Sulfides in Gut Health

In the human gut, dietary sulfur is metabolized by certain bacteria, like sulfate-reducing bacteria (SRB), which produce hydrogen sulfide gas. While H₂S plays a role as a signaling molecule, high levels can potentially harm gut health, particularly in individuals with inflammatory bowel conditions like ulcerative colitis. A diet high in animal proteins and low in fiber has been suggested to promote SRB growth and increase sulfide production. Conversely, some vegetables high in sulfur, particularly cruciferous types, may have a different effect, highlighting the complexity of dietary impact.

Comparison of High-Sulfide Food Groups

This table provides a quick overview of different food groups and their primary sulfur-related considerations.

Food Group Primary Sulfur Compounds Dietary Considerations
Allium Vegetables Organosulfur compounds (allicin, allyl sulfides) Potential for gas and bloating in sensitive individuals, but linked to strong health benefits.
Cruciferous Vegetables Glucosinolates (sulforaphane) Offer powerful antioxidants and health protection. Some find them hard to digest.
Animal Proteins Amino acids (methionine, cysteine) Major source of dietary sulfur. Can increase gut sulfide production, particularly with high intake.
Dairy Products Amino acids; fermentation byproducts Cheeses, especially aged, have higher sulfur content. Fermentation process increases compounds.
Dried Fruits & Preservatives Sulfites (sulfur dioxide) Common allergen/sensitivity trigger for asthmatic and sensitive individuals.

Managing High-Sulfide Food Intake

For most people, a balanced diet that includes a variety of sulfur-rich foods is healthy and beneficial. However, if you have known sensitivities or gastrointestinal issues, especially inflammatory bowel diseases, you may need to monitor your intake.

  • Balance is Key: Instead of eliminating entire food groups, focus on consuming a diverse range of foods in moderation. For example, pair sulfur-rich animal proteins with high-fiber, low-sulfur vegetables.
  • Monitor Symptoms: Pay attention to how your body reacts to different foods. Digestive issues like bloating or gas can sometimes be linked to high sulfur intake.
  • Reduce Preservatives: If you are sensitive to sulfites, read food labels carefully and reduce your consumption of dried fruits, processed foods, and certain beverages that use them as preservatives.
  • Adjust Cooking Methods: The way you prepare food can impact its sulfur content. For example, overcooking eggs intensifies their sulfurous odor.
  • Seek Professional Advice: For serious concerns or before making major dietary changes, consult a healthcare provider or a registered dietitian.
